Klyde Warren Park
★ 4.7A vibrant 5.2-acre deck park bridging Downtown and Uptown Dallas
Built over the recessed Woodall Rodgers Freeway, Klyde Warren Park is a central gathering space offering daily free programming, food trucks, interactive fountains, botanical gardens, and lush lawns with stunning Dallas skyline views.
Dallas Museum of Art
★ 4.7One of the nation's premier encyclopedic art institutions
Anchoring the Dallas Arts District, the Dallas Museum of Art features a globally renowned collection of over 25,000 works spanning 5,000 years of human creativity, from ancient Mediterranean artifacts to modern masterworks, offering free general admission.
The Dallas Arboretum and Botanical Garden
★ 4.7A picturesque 66-acre botanical oasis on the shores of White Rock Lake
Ranked among the top floral gardens in the world, the Dallas Arboretum offers 66 acres of breathtaking seasonal displays, historic estates, serene water features, and family-friendly interactive children's gardens.
Reunion Tower
★ 4.7Panoramic 360-degree observation deck defining the Dallas skyline
Standing 561 feet tall with its iconic geodesic dome, Reunion Tower's GeO-Deck provides breathtaking 360-degree panoramic views of downtown Dallas, high-definition zoom cameras, interactive touchscreens, and outdoor observation walkways.
